Breaking Barriers: Vaughan Roberts

Bacchus Vaughan Roberts, better known as Vaughan Roberts, is a well-known evangelical leader in the United Kingdom. In his influential book Battles Christians Face, Roberts included a detailed chapter on Homosexuality, based on his own personal experience. By sharing his journey, Roberts not only faced criticism but also garnered a degree of support from both the LGBTQ community and certain segments of the Christian faith. His openness paved the way for more inclusive discussions within churches and Evangelical communities.
